Help, we are preparing an area of our garden for an eglu. The plan is to place it on soil with wood chippings, reading some articles on this website im concerned now that perhaps i should slab an area. Any advice would be great

 

Can i also only have two chicken with the run size that comes with the e

glu without extending it. I am looking at hybrid birds at present

Hello, yes they will be fine in the basic run. Some swear by chips on soil some by chips on slabs so either are fine. :D

 

If they are on slabs just rake away the chips and you can clean the slabs and put some safe disinfectant down.

 

On soil rake away chips, dig over soil and use some safe disinfectant and a bit of garden lime to sweeten the soil.

 

You will need a bit more chips on slabs to make a 3-4 in depth but on soil you can get away with having it shallow and top up when needed. :D

 

The disinfectants usually mentioned on here are Stalosan F or Biodry but I am sure there are others.
